Customer Service Executive Salary in New York

How much does a Customer Service Executive make in New York?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Customer Service Executive in New York is $257,556 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$124.

However, a Customer Service Executive's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$300,240
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$233,980 to $279,898
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$212,515

Key Factors That Influence Customer Service Executive Salaries

A Customer Service Executive's salary isn't a fixed number. It's shaped by several important factors. Below, we'll explore how your years of experience, geographic location and company size can directly affect your earning potential.

How Experience Level Affects Customer Service Executive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Customer Service Executive's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here’s how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$78,305
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$103,310
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$141,732
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$185,679
  • Expert (over 8 years): $255,914

Customer Service Executive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Customer Service Executive ro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 59%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Financial Services and Biotechnology s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 20% above the average. In contrast, Customer Service Executive positions in Transportation or Edu., Gov't. & Nonprofit typ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Customer Service Executive as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
